The government policies in the Philippines related to the Preterm Birth and PROM (Premature Rupture of Membranes) Testing Market primarily focus on improving maternal and child health outcomes. The Department of Health (DOH) implements programs such as the Maternal, Newborn, Child Health and Nutrition Strategy to reduce preterm births and complications related to PROM. The government encourages the use of evidence-based practices in maternal healthcare, including timely and accurate testing for PROM to prevent potential risks to both the mother and the baby. Additionally, the Philippine Health Insurance Corporation (PhilHealth) provides coverage for certain maternal health services, including preterm birth prevention measures and PROM testing, ensuring access to these essential healthcare services for a wider population.
